Hello Luke and Robert,
Apologies for the inconveniences. This is definitely not an intentional change but a bug. We’ve been able to reproduce it in our development environment, and we’ve created an issue in our GitHub repository to keep track on it.We’ll fix it as soon as possible and include it on the next release.
In the meantime…
- On the Discover tab, you can still see a full list of alerts clicking on the
Discoverbutton.- On the Agents tab, you can see visualizations tailored for each specific agents, because we use the
agent.idfield to filter them.Regards,

I've noticed this as well. I'm particularly curious if the change from agent.name to precoder.hostname is intentional or a bug? If it's a bug, I don't want to change all my visualizations to use precoder.hostname.--As Robert mentioned, the only hosts to show up under agent.name are my manager names - no agents.Thanks,
On Friday, August 31, 2018 at 7:59:41 PM UTC-4, Robert H wrote:Okay, I fixed my dashboard. I was using agent.name in the visualizations. I had to change that to predecoder.hostname.But my Top 5 Agent and most/all of the similar visuals on the Overview pages all seem off. Anything where agent names used to show up, now only shows my 2 managers or says no results, but there is alert data in the table views. Top agents for vulnerabilities, show no agent names in the box, but there is data in the graph, etc.I think something is mixed up in the app pages.Regards,Robert
